Grover, renowned for his iconic characters such as Gutthi, Dr. Mashoor Gulati, and Rinku Bhabhi from "Comedy Nights with Kapil" and "The Kapil Sharma Show," has become a household name in Indian comedy. His performances are characterized by unique humor, mimicry, and physical comedy, delighting audiences across the country. He holds a master's degree in theatre from Panjab University, Chandigarh.

Beyond his television success, Grover has also featured in movies such as "Gabbar Is Back", "Bharat", and "Jawan", and has received acclaim for his roles in web series like "Sunflower" and "Tandav". He has also been a part of several live comedy tours and events, including "Comedy Overload," showcasing his ability to connect with live audiences and deliver fresh, family-friendly humor. He is known for incorporating interactive sessions and engaging with contemporary issues through his relatable comedy.
Grover's ability to impersonate Bollywood stars, particularly Amitabh Bachchan and Salman Khan, has also garnered him critical praise. His contributions to the comedy scene have been recognized with awards such as the ITA Award for Special Comic Icon in 2018. He has also received nominations for Indian Telly Awards.
